Here's what you have to understand about Millennium Dreams, Journey, Storming Heaven and, really, about most of my work. I tend to write long better than I write short. Short is mainly to get stuff out of my system. But, writing the longer fics involves continuity issues. I think that waiting to show anyone All Too Human, ...on the Highway of... and Puppy Dog Eyes until they were complete was the best move I could have made. Ditto Crossed Lines, although that was a quick fic that has a very flawed ending that perhaps a bit of time could have fixed. That's another issue. The point is, it is entirely possible that posting Journey and SH a chapter at a time was a big mistake from the point of view of telling a cohesive story. There are continuity errors in Journey that aggravate me no end. By not waiting until the story was done, I allowed myself time and distance, and the ability to keep working at a more leisurely pace, but this means I have to work harder to get back into the framework of the story when I return to it. The longer the story gets, the more material I have to re-read before I can move on to the next bit. That doesn't happen nearly as much when I write something in its entirety before posting.

So, the plan remains: get Journey to a logical place to take a break from it, wrap up SH, work on a few other odds and ends, then go back to MD. I have plans for that fic. They aren't abandoned, they are just delayed.
